College of Co-Operation Banking and Management, Vellanikkara Admission Process

College of Co-operation Banking and Management, Vellanikkara, provides specialised training in co-operation, banking, and management. The College of Co-operation Banking and Management's admission process is framed to admit the best-suited students for its wide array of undergraduate, postgraduate, and doctoral courses.

The College of Co-operation Banking and Management's admission process adopts a merit-based process, and the criteria for admission to different courses are different. The College of Co-operation Banking and Management admission process for undergraduate courses the college has its own entrance test. College of Co-operation Banking and Management admission process for postgraduate courses, especially MBA courses, the scores of national-level entrance exams in management, like KMAT, CMAT, and CAT, are considered.

College of Co-operation Banking and Management admission process eligibility levels vary in programmes. The College of Co-operation Banking and Management admission process for undergraduate programmes requires the candidates to have passed 10+2 from a recognised board. The College of Co-operation Banking and Management admission process for postgraduation studies requires a bachelor's degree in the concerned stream. College of Co-operation Banking and Management admission process for doctoral programmes can require a master's degree and look for publication and performance in interviews.

College of Co-operation Banking and Management Application Process

The college application process of the Vellanikkara College of Co-operation Banking and Management differs for different programmes:

  • For B.Sc Co-operation and Banking (Hons):
    • Get admitted to the entrance test of the college
    • Appear for the entrance exam
    • Merit list prepared based on marks obtained in entrance exam
  • For MBA Agribusiness Management:
    • Appear for one of the accepted entrance exams: KMAT, CMAT, or CAT
    • Apply to the college based on the score in the qualifying exam
    • Shortlisted candidates appear for Group Discussion and Personal Interview
    • Final selection on the basis of composite score (80% entrance exam, 10% GD, 10% PI)
  • For M.Sc. Co-operation and Banking:
    • Take the entrance exam organised by the syndicate
    • Take the entrance test
    • Shortlist on the basis of performance in the entrance exam
  • For Ph.D Rural Marketing Management:
    • Apply with academic record and publication
    • Interview by shortlisted panellists
    • Final shortlist on the basis of OGPA, publication, and interview performance

College of Co-operation Banking and Management B.Sc Co-operation and Banking (Hons) Admission Process

The College of Co-operation Banking and Management offers a B.Sc Co-operation and Banking (Hons) programme. Admission is merit-based as per the marks secured in entrance exam conducted by the college. The course gives a solid foundation in the co-operative sector as well as bank theory.

College of Co-operation Banking and Management MBA Agribusiness Management Admission Process

The College of Co-operation Banking and Management offers an MBA Agribusiness Management programme. Admission is very competitive and merit-based. The choice is made based on:

  • Qualifying marks in KMAT, CMAT, or CAT exams
  • A rank list prepared with the following weightage:
  • 80% for entrance examination marks (KMAT/CMAT/CAT)
  • 10% for Group Discussion
  • 10% for Personal Interview

The course is accredited for admission of 40 students.

College of Co-operation Banking and Management M.Sc. Co-operation and Banking Admission Process

The College of Co-operation Banking and Management offers an M.Sc. Co-operation and Banking programme. The candidates have to undergo an examination by the college syndicate. The course provides specialised knowledge in banking branches and co-operative management.

College of Co-operation Banking and Management M.Sc. Rural Marketing Management Admission Process

The College of Co-operation Banking and Management offers an M.Sc. Rural Marketing Management programme. It will probably be the same as other postgraduate courses, maybe including an entrance test and interview.

College of Co-operation Banking and Management Ph.D Rural Marketing Management Admission Process

The College of Co-operation Banking and Management offers a Ph.D Rural Marketing Management programme. Admission takes into account various factors:

  • The applicant's OGPA (Overall Grade Point Average)
  • Quality and quantity of publications
  • Performance during interview by the college
